Real-World Testing: Putting Fenwick HMX Spinning Rod to the Test
First Use Experience
I first tested the Fenwick HMX Spinning Rod on a local lake known for its largemouth bass and panfish. I paired it with a size 2500 spinning reel and 8-pound test monofilament line. I planned to start with a Texas-rigged worm for bass, switching to a small jig for panfish later.
The weather was partly cloudy, with a slight breeze and a water temperature of around 65 degrees Fahrenheit. I casted from the bank, targeting weed lines and submerged structures. The rod handled the Texas-rigged worm with ease, allowing me to accurately cast and feel the bottom structure.
The Fenwick HMX Spinning Rod required very little time to get used to. The rod’s fast action tip made it easy to detect subtle strikes, and the medium power backbone provided plenty of strength for setting the hook.
The biggest surprise was the rod’s sensitivity. I could feel every pebble and weed as I dragged the worm along the bottom. The rod transmitted the slightest nibbles from panfish, allowing for quick and effective hooksets.

Breaking Down the Features of Fenwick HMX Spinning Rod
Specifications
Guides: Eight guides constructed with durable, strong, and lightweight stainless steel frames and titanium oxide inserts. These guides minimize friction and ensure smooth line flow for longer casts and improved sensitivity.
Line Lb/Test: Rated for 4-12 pound test line. This range makes the rod versatile enough for a variety of species and fishing techniques, from light line finesse fishing to slightly heavier applications.
Lure Weight/Oz: Designed to handle lures weighing between 1/8 and 3/4 ounces. This range is ideal for many popular lures, including jigs, spinnerbaits, crankbaits, and various soft plastics.
Rod Length: 6’6″ provides a good balance of casting distance and accuracy. This length also offers sufficient leverage for fighting fish in various environments.
Rod Pieces: One-piece construction enhances sensitivity and strength by eliminating potential weak points. This design ensures optimal performance and feel.
Rod Power: Medium power offers a versatile balance between sensitivity and strength. It allows anglers to feel subtle strikes while still providing enough backbone to handle larger fish.
Rod Tip Action: Fast action means the rod bends primarily near the tip. This provides excellent sensitivity for detecting strikes and quick hooksets.
Rod Material: Graphite construction ensures a lightweight and sensitive feel. The cross-scrim graphite construction further enhances strength and durability.
Handle Material: A combination of TAC (Tacky Adhesive Comfort) and cork provides a comfortable and secure grip. TAC material ensures a non-slip grip, even when wet, while the cork offers a classic look and feel.
Additional Features: Includes a TAC rod butt and a rod hook keeper. The TAC rod butt provides added comfort during long days of fishing, while the rod hook keeper keeps lures secure when not in use.
These specifications are important because they directly impact the rod’s performance, sensitivity, and versatility. The right combination of length, power, and action can make a significant difference in an angler’s ability to detect strikes, cast accurately, and effectively fight fish.
